What hair styling tools did women in the 80’s use to curl/wave their hair?

  • Electric heating irons
  • Electric Marcel Irons
  • Crimping Waving Irons
  • Perming Rod Sets
  • Rollers with clamps or crimps
  • Portable Bonnet Hair Dryers
  • Small handheld blow dryers
